Is Suffolk, VA a buyer's or seller's market?

As of May 2026, Suffolk, VA is classified as a Balanced Market, based on its Alpha Score of 53 out of 100. The classification reflects current price, inventory, affordability, economic, and rental-yield conditions.

Are home prices rising or falling in Suffolk, VA?

The median sale price in Suffolk, VA is $405K, having fallen 4.8% over the past year.

How affordable is Suffolk, VA?

Suffolk, VA scores 21 out of 100 on affordability — relatively unaffordable relative to local incomes and prevailing mortgage rates compared with other counties.
